On Wed, Oct 08, 2014 at 05:26:11AM -0700, Joe Perches wrote:
> On Wed, 2014-10-08 at 13:40 +0300, Dan Carpenter wrote:
> > The return from myid() isn't aligned correctly for ether_addr_copy().
>
> Hey Dan.
>
> Actual evidence showing ether_addr_copy conversions
> may not always be wise.
>
> How did you find them?
I was just trying to see how common these kinds of bugs are. It didn't
take long to find, but my impression is that they are rare and I got
lucky. These kinds of bugs are tricky to find and we don't have any
tools for it.
